Excellent location on the south-east side of Windermere (lake). Impressive reception and open plan lounge with amazing lake views. Good food at reasonable price. Free continental breakfast included in room price, but cooked breakfast charged (at £15 pp). Friendly staff. Spa facilities are good, though busy during our visit (early Jan 2025). Very popular with couples. Bowness is appox 4 miles north of the hotel.

Car parking is free, with some limited spaces outside the hotel (roadside). However, the main hotel car park is down a VERY steep ramp, which makes it difficult (even dangerous) to exit onto the road. Hotel charges extra for use of the pool (£10 pp per 24 hrs).

Frequently Asked Questions - Beech Hill Hotel & Spa

At what times are check-in and check-out at Beech Hill Hotel & Spa?

Your reservation at Beech Hill Hotel & Spa includes a check-in time of 04:00 PM and a check-out time of 11:00 AM.

Does Beech Hill Hotel & Spa provide parking options?

Yes, there is ample parking available at Beech Hill Hotel & Spa. You can park your vehicle for free in the public parking lot located on-site. No reservation is required, making it convenient for guests to find parking upon arrival.

How much does a stay at Beech Hill Hotel & Spa cost?

The entry-level price at Beech Hill Hotel & Spa is $121. These rates are subject to change based on room selection and travel dates. Kindly input your dates to view current rates.

What types of rooms does Beech Hill Hotel & Spa offer?

The Beech Hill Hotel & Spa offers a variety of room types, including Standard Double Rooms, Premier Plus Double Rooms, Standard Family Rooms, Select Plus Double Rooms, Classic Non Lake View Double or Twin Rooms, Standard Double Rooms with Lake View, Standard Single Rooms, Select Double Rooms, Compact Double Rooms with Lake View, Select Double or Twin Rooms, Executive Suites, Premier Double Rooms, and Deluxe Suites with Hot Tub. Occupancy ranges from single to double, with some rooms accommodating an additional child. Smoking is not allowed in any of the rooms. Room sizes vary, with the smallest room being 86 sqft and the largest being 301 sqft. Bed sizes range from Twin to Queen and King.
